Brooklyn: Mike D'Antoni to join Steve Nash's five-star staff

2020-10-30T18:15:05.900Z


The former Houston coach will don the assistant costume of the one who was his player in Phoenix and the Los Angeles Lakers. 


Mike D'Antoni is about to find a new employer.

But not as a head coach.

From

ESPN's

Adrian Wojnarowski

, the former Houston coach will take over Brooklyn and officiate there as an assistant to the one who was his player in Phoenix and the Lakers, Steve Nash.

Ime Udoka will also join the staff of coach Nash, still according to “Woj”, who specifies that the two technicians are in the process of “finalizing” their contract with the Nets.

For his first season as head coach, Nash therefore made the choice to surround himself with experienced coaches.

We know that Jacque Vaughn and Amare Stoudemire will also be part of this five-star staff, intended to guide Kevin Durant, Kyrie Irving and company to the highest peaks of the NBA next season.

Steve Nash played four years (2004-08) under Mike D'Antoni in Phoenix, winning two regular season MVP titles (2005, 2006), and two years with the Lakers (2012- 14).

Aged 69, and twice coach of the year (2005, 2017), the Italian-American technician has also managed Denver, New York and therefore Houston.

He has also been an assistant with the Nuggets, Suns and 76ers.

His record as a number 1 coach?

672 wins and 527 losses.

With the Rockets, over the past four years, he has a record of 217 wins for 101 losses.

Ime Udoka, 43, was Gregg Popovich's assistant for a long time on the San Antonio side (2012-2019), before taking over the management of Philadelphia, under Brett Brown, for a year.

He had been talked about for several head coaching positions this summer.
